Meeting in Luxembourg on Friday 17 October for the ‘Employment, Social Policy, Health and Consumer Affairs’ Council (EPSCO), the European ministers for equality reopened the thorny issue of the notion of consent in the fight against sexual violence.
In an interview with Agence Europe - to be published on Monday 20 October - the Danish Minister for the Environment and Gender Equality, Magnus Heunicke, regretted that the 2024 directive did not include a European definition of rape...
